Defensive End | Senior | Wisconsin 
Matt Shaughnessy
Height: 6-5 | Weight: 266 | 40-Time: 4.88
Matt Shaughnessy | Wisconsin Badgers
Official Bio

Stars
Strengths:
Very good size with long arms the frame to add more weight...Good strength and power...Gets a nice push as a bull rusher...Uses his hands well to get off blocks...Comfortable in space...Excellent motor...Does a terrific job in pursuit..Quick...Nice instincts and awareness...Versatile.

Weaknesses:
Does not always use proper leverage...Just average timed speed and isn't very explosive...Needs to develop more pass rush moves...Not stout at the point...Struggles  in  coverage...Some  durability concerns.

Notes:
A four-year starter in the Big Ten...Grandfather, James Shaughnessy, played football at Arnold College...1st Team Freshman All-American in 2005...2nd Team All-Big Ten in 2006 and 2007...Tore his ACL in 2005...Broke his right fibula in the Spring of 2008...Could also project to outside linebacker and has some experience inside at defensive tackle...'Tweener who isn't the top pass rusher you look for in a right end or the stout run defender you want in a left end...Backup  material.


Career Statistics
Year GP TKL TFL SACK
2005 11 39 7.5 2.5
2006 13 35 8.0 4.0
2007 13 60 18.0 5.0
2008 13 40 8.0 4.0
Totals 50 174 41.5 15.5
